How they compare

Chile currently reports 1.2 against 1.2 in Syria, a difference of 0.

The two have swapped places 2 times across 39 shared years of data; in 1980 it was Syria ahead.

Chile ranks 62nd and Syria ranks 62nd of 191 countries.

Across the 4 decades both report, Chile averaged higher in 2 and Syria in 1.

Head to head by decade

Decade Chile Syria Difference Ahead
1980s 1.08 1.1 0.02 Syria
1990s 1.15 1.1 0.05 Chile
2000s 1.2 1.13 0.07 Chile
2010s 1.2 1.2 0

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

The estimated average level of high-density lipoprotein (HDL) cholesterol, commonly known as "good cholesterol". Healthy levels are considered to be 1mmol/L or above for men or 1.2mmol/L or above for women.
